I'm going to replace my psu as im having some issues with my graphics card and im not sure what else to do. I have an asus r9 270x it says on the box that the minimum psu is 500 watts and i only have a 430 watt psu does this matter? You can power way more beastily cards on a 450W Silverstone SFX psu, let alone needing 500w for a 270X. Manufacturer numbers are always highly exaggerated vs what a kilowatt meter reads as the actual power draw. This is assuming the PSU is decent. While you don't need crazy high wattage for even a single high end GPU solution, you do need a quality unit. It needs to provide enough amps on the 12v rail(s) for stability.

Here's a link to another thread I posted about my card issue: http://linustechtips.com/main/topic/257682-graphics-card-buzzing-plz-help/

That is one of 2 things:

 

- It's coil whine

- It's fan rattling

 

Download MSI Afterburner and manually set the fans to about 70-80% and run something like Unigine Valley. Then while the fans are spinning stop them by apply force to the center of the fans with your fingers. If the buzzing stops, it's the fans that are damaged, if the buzzing continues, it's coil whine and there's nothing you can do about that.
